/* Definitions of target machine for GNU compiler, for "naked" Intel
   80960 using coff object format and coff debugging symbols.
   Copyright (C) 1988, 1989, 1991 Intel Corp.
   Contributed by Steven McGeady ([email protected])
   Additional work by Glenn Colon-Bonet, Jonathan Shapiro, Andy Wilson
   Converted to GCC 2.0 by Michael Tiemann, Cygnus Support.
 */

#include "i960/i960.h"

/* Generate SDB_DEBUGGING_INFO by default.  */
#undef PREFERRED_DEBUGGING_TYPE
#define PREFERRED_DEBUGGING_TYPE SDB_DEBUG

#undef ASM_FILE_START
#define ASM_FILE_START(FILE) \
  output_file_directive ((FILE), main_input_filename)

/* Support the ctors and dtors sections for g++.  */

#define CTORS_SECTION_ASM_OP	".section\t.ctors,\"x\""
#define DTORS_SECTION_ASM_OP	".section\t.dtors,\"x\""

/* A list of other sections which the compiler might be "in" at any
   given time.  */

#undef EXTRA_SECTIONS
#define EXTRA_SECTIONS in_ctors, in_dtors

/* A list of extra section function definitions.  */

#undef EXTRA_SECTION_FUNCTIONS
#define EXTRA_SECTION_FUNCTIONS						\
  CTORS_SECTION_FUNCTION						\
  DTORS_SECTION_FUNCTION

#define CTORS_SECTION_FUNCTION						\
void									\
ctors_section ()							\
{									\
  if (in_section != in_ctors)						\
    {									\
      fprintf (asm_out_file, "%s\n", CTORS_SECTION_ASM_OP);		\
      in_section = in_ctors;						\
    }									\
}

#define DTORS_SECTION_FUNCTION						\
void									\
dtors_section ()							\
{									\
  if (in_section != in_dtors)						\
    {									\
      fprintf (asm_out_file, "%s\n", DTORS_SECTION_ASM_OP);		\
      in_section = in_dtors;						\
    }									\
}

#define INT_ASM_OP ".word"

/* A C statement (sans semicolon) to output an element in the table of
   global constructors.  */
#define ASM_OUTPUT_CONSTRUCTOR(FILE,NAME)				\
  do {									\
    ctors_section ();							\
    fprintf (FILE, "\t%s\t ", INT_ASM_OP);				\
    assemble_name (FILE, NAME);						\
    fprintf (FILE, "\n");						\
  } while (0)

/* A C statement (sans semicolon) to output an element in the table of
   global destructors.  */
#define ASM_OUTPUT_DESTRUCTOR(FILE,NAME)       				\
  do {									\
    dtors_section ();                   				\
    fprintf (FILE, "\t%s\t ", INT_ASM_OP);				\
    assemble_name (FILE, NAME);              				\
    fprintf (FILE, "\n");						\
  } while (0)

/* end of i960-coff.h */
